What to Expect (Job Responsibilities):
- Interpret diagnostic test results and review clinical information
- Apply variant classification guidelines and generate accurate clinical testing result reports
- Stay updated on current theories and principles of human genetics
- Evaluate genetic data and literature
- Demonstrate excellent written and verbal communication skills
What is Required (Qualifications):
- Master's degree in Genetic Counseling from an accredited institution
How to Stand Out (Preferred Qualifications):
- ABGC Board Certification and state licensure (when applicable)
- Prior clinical or laboratory experience
- Familiarity with diagnostic testing methodologies, including next-generation and Sanger sequencing, microarray, and MLPA
